ROUND CUSHION

Pattern from Reader Another pattern of a round cushion which has been kindly supplied by one of “The Dominion’s” readers is as follows: — ■ , . , This pattern is worked in garter stitch and takes seven skeins of wool, three pink, three green, and one black. Use No. 9 needles. Cast on 72 stitches in black, knit 4 rows garter stitch, join on green wool. First row: Knit 68 green, 4 black. Second row: Knit 4 black, 68 green. Third row: Knit 64 green. Fourth row: Knit 64 green. Fifth row: Knit 60 green. Continue working this way four less every alternate row, until you have knitted the last four. Join on black, knit four more, rows garter stitch, then join on pink, continue working in the same way, always keeping the four black at the .top. Work this pattern until you have a circle (about 20 altogether). Join up one side. Finish centre with crochet flowers.
